- Alejandro Flores DiazJan 11, 2022 · 4 years agoInvesting in digital currencies instead of traditional precious metals like palladium and gold can be a risky but potentially rewarding endeavor. Digital currencies have the potential for high returns, especially during bull markets. However, they also come with significant risks. The market for digital currencies is highly volatile, which means that prices can fluctuate dramatically in short periods of time. This volatility can lead to substantial losses if investors are not careful. Additionally, the regulatory environment for digital currencies is still developing, which introduces uncertainty and potential risks. It's important for investors to carefully assess their risk tolerance and conduct thorough research before investing in digital currencies.
